Prometheus Releases MyCeliacID, a Saliva-based Celiac Disease Genetic Test

Here is an interesting press release was received and got permission to pass along to our readers regarding a new test which uses your saliva to test for the Celiac gene.  Prometheus Laboratories Inc., a specialty pharmaceutical and diagnostic company, yesterday announced the launch of MyCeliacID, the first do it yourself, saliva-based genetic test dedicated to [...]

Celiac Disease Home Test Now Available in Canada

If you’ve been reading this site for awhile, you may remember we discussed a Celiac home test that was in the works last October.   Well, it looks like just recently this new Celiac Disease home test became available in Canada at London Drugs, Rexall Pharma Plus, and other major Canadian retail chains!
